| Family | HYPERICACEAE |
| Genus species | Hypericum kotschyanum Boiss. sect. Taeniocarpium |
| Bibliography | Diagn. Pl. Orient. 1: 56 (1843) |
| Native Range | s. Turkey |
| Primary Biome | Temperate |
| Habitat | rocks |
| Altitude | 1700-2500m |
| Description | leaves linear-lanceolate to narrowly oblong, 5-15mm long, scabrous pubescent, corolla 15-25mm, petals often red striate, inflorescence narrow, pyramidal or spicate panicle |
| Size | 10-30cm |
| Color | yellow |
| Bloom | early summer |
| Ca | + |
| Type | perennial |
| Cultivation | sunny rock crevices, protection against winter wet alpine house, poor, drained soil, sun |
| Propagation | seed in spring, barely covered, germ. 1-3 months, 10-16°C division in spring; cuttings in late summer |
| Synonyms | Hypericum repens var. hirtellum Jaub. & Spach Hypericum velutinum Boiss. |
| Territory | 3 Asia-Temperate 34 Western Asia (TUR Turkey) |
